This book contains strong language, and adult themes that may not be suitable for everyone. Jenny sits in the same seat on the same train every week, seeing familiar faces come and go. Until a chance encounter shatters her world. Sixteen years ago, Jenny survived a traumatic ordeal that left her best friend, Susie, missing and presumed dead. The world has its theories about what happened to Susie Patterson, and one of those theories points the finger at Jenny. Now she lives a quiet life, volunteering at a crisis helpline while trying to deal with her own anxiety and the true crime fans obsessed with finding her missing friend. Then, on the way to her usual shift, Jenny is certain she sees Susie sitting in coach D. But will anyone believe her? Seeing Susie plunges Jenny back into a nightmare of forgotten memories and haunting fears. As the past claws its way into her present, she must unravel the truth about what happened sixteen years ago. But the deeper she digs, the more she realises that some secrets are better left buried.
